The book, Finding Freedom: Harry and Meghan and the Making of a Modern Royal Family, contends that the two wives never quite saw things the same way from the start. And while that rift isn’t exactly Kate’s fault, per se, some of the expectations for a smooth, healthy relationship do necessarily fall on her considering she was the ‘veteran’ in this instance.

The book’s authors, Omid Scobie and Carolyn Durand, noted how the two women were “not at war with each other,” though admitted each one suffered some “awkward moments” that ultimately helped define their relationship. That included (below):

“Though it was not necessarily her responsibility, Kate did little to bridge the divide. They didn’t [share that much] in common other than the fact that they lived at Kensington Palace.”

BTW, dirt or not, a spokesperson for Meghan and Harry previously released a statement about their (alleged lack of) involvement in this book, saying:

“The Duke and Duchess of Sussex were not interviewed and did not contribute to Finding Freedom. This book is based on the authors’ own experiences as members of the royal press corps and their own independent reporting.”
